2 . Last summer I volunteered at a nursing home (疗养院) because I saw how lonely some of the old people there were.
I volunteered two days a week. I worked with Mr. Simpsons, and our job was to plan activities for the old people. I read them letters from their children and helped with special days like Ice Cream Day, Summer Picnic Day, and Clown Around Day. I also took the sick people for walks. We also had birthday parties and exercise days.
Through my volunteering I have made a new friend—Irene. She has family, but they live far away and cannot come to visit her often. She grew up in Shelton and lived in Milford before she came to the home. She has two sons who don’t often visit her. Her grandchildren, however, do visit her every weekend. Through our talks, I have found that like me, Irene was a cheerleader (拉拉队队员) in high school.
My volunteer experience showed me that I could bring happiness to the old people. Everyone will have to face having parents and grandparents growing older. Volunteering at the nursing home made me a stronger and more caring person.

3 . In 2015, seven college students in America started a project (项目) called Spokes. They planned to ride across the United States. Did they start the project for health reasons? No. They did this to get more kids interested in science. On their way, they would stop in small towns and hold classes for younger students. The trip began in Washington, D.C on June 1 and finished in California at the end of August. The Spokes team went to schools. They invited students from grades 6 to 12 to join their classes. Some of their lessons were about engineering (工程学). Others were about computer science. The students learned many interesting things from these classes, such as how to make model planes and robots. They liked the lessons so much. Spokes members were glad to see this. “We can’t teach them programming (编程) in a day,” Bent, a member of the Spokes team, said. “But we can get them excited about programming and show them science is cool. Then, kids might think about taking jobs in science when they grow up.”

6 . It was Mother’s Day. Chatham was driving his new blue car and enjoying the beauty of nature. A flower shop by the road came into his eyes. So he stopped his car and took a look at some of the flowers. Just then he found a small, cute girl standing next to the shop. She was counting the money in her hand.It seemed that she was a little unhappy.
He went up to her and asked, “Can I help you?” “I want to buy some red flowers for my mother. But I have only eighty rupees (卢比),” said the girl.
Chatham smiled and asked her to take him to the shop. He bought a big bouquet(花束) for her and said, “I can take you to your mother.” The girl was very happy.
Finally they got to a grave. “Thank you, Uncle.” Then she ran to the grave and put the roses in front of it.
Chatham stood there without words in a minute. He then made a U-turn (掉头) and drove back to the same flower shop. He picked some pink roses and drove down two hundred miles to meet his old mother. His mother was happy to see him. But she said, “Why do you drive down all the way? You could talk to me over the phone.”
He just kissed his mother and said, “Happy Mother’s Day!”

There is a river between a small village and the village school in a town of Hainan Province, but no bridge over the river there. Two teachers of the village school insist on carrying the children on their backs across the river to go to school. The 54-year-old teacher, Wang Wenzhou is also the headmaster of the village school. The other teacher, Wang Shengchao, is 45 years old. Both the two teachers have been doing this for many years day after day. The river is about twenty metres wide.
Wang Shengchao said that his father carried him across the river when he was young. Now he does the same thing as his father did. He will carry little children on his back across the river if their parents can not send them to school. Many parents are thankful to them for their good manners. The life in this village school is very hard. Many teachers left the school because of the hard conditions (条件). In September it rained heavily every day so the river became very deep. Children could not go to school during that time. They had been back and forth between the school and the river.
They hope that the local government can build a bridge over the river so that they can go to school easily. But one of the officials said they had not enough money to build such a bridge because it would cost one million yuan. Who can help them?
